E-BRIM usage by B40 citizens: The role of citizens' trust and computer self-efficacy
E-BR1M (Bantuan Rakyat 1 Malaysia) is an e-government application that was introduced to facilitate the efficiency of The People Living Assistance program in Malaysia.
